Eden Allure offers products that are based from Argan Oil. I was sent three products from Eden Allure, which are pictured below.


   Argan oil is amazing for your skin and body because it is rich in essential fatty acids, which your skin needs. It is also rich in Vitamin F which is good for anti-aging and anti-dryness of the skin. It also is noted to have Vitamin E, which is great for sensitive skin and UV protection.

  I really enjoyed using the beauty bars from Eden Allure as well. The first one I used was the Lavender one, since Lavender is one of my favorite smells, and has a nice calming effect. Beauty Bars can be used where ever you'd like on your body. I used mine on my arms, legs, and sometimes face while in the shower. It lathered very well, just like a normal soap. The great thing about these beauty bars are that they don't have any harsh chemicals that you'd find in your everyday soaps. These beauty bars are made with organic coconut oil, organic palm oil, organic sunflower oil, and of course Argan oil. 
I saw a difference in my skin in the first week. Instead of the tight, uncomfortable feeling I would get after getting out of the shower, my skin was extremely smooth to the touch. The scent of the beauty bars seems strong when using it in the shower, but the scent doesn't linger. I wasn't the biggest fan of the smell of the grapefruit one, but again I didn't mind, since the smell didn't linger after getting out of the shower. The beauty bars lasted me about a month each, with me being the only person that used it.
